Output 59a2fdf6d111502649fdfe834ee4538ff40564ecd3b9be10a6299c4b2e23a93a:5

value
27738462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ea234cf64a6eba744f4533715db91abd9ddc493 OP_EQUAL
address
MAh8pUYSncPGbCMKvJyUSiiU58CzSkZTmq
transaction
59a2fdf6d111502649fdfe834ee4538ff40564ecd3b9be10a6299c4b2e23a93a
spent
true